Sarajevo, a city at risk
A few years after they signed Peace Treaty with their enemies (Serbian Army), Bosnia and Sarajevo as their capital presented still clear scars of what war meant to them. As it is said hundreds of times, it was the worst conflict in European soil after Second War World. All suffered and committed terrible crimes against people who just a few years before were neighbors spending free time together. Before war, there were three main ethnic groups: Bosnians (Muslims), Croatians (catholic) and Serbians (orthodox) and there was usual to know about marriages among members from different ethnic groups. After, there was just in real terms a big one: Muslims. Wounds were and still are nowadays too painful to be forgotten and forgiven. At that time, when I went there, in 2006, there were looking at Europe. Now I wish they still keep trying to look forward for a better future.
